在信息化时代,网络安全是每个网民都需要关注的问题。端口扫描是网络安全检测的重要手段之一,可以帮助我们发现网络中的安全隐患。今天,就让我来教你如何轻松下载并使用一款网络端口扫描神器,帮助你快速检测网络安全隐患。
一、了解端口扫描
在开始使用端口扫描工具之前,我们先来了解一下什么是端口扫描。端口是计算机上的一种通信接口,用于网络中的设备之间进行数据交换。每个端口都对应着一种服务,如HTTP、FTP等。端口扫描就是通过自动检测目标主机的端口状态,来判断其上运行的服务,从而发现潜在的安全风险。
二、选择合适的端口扫描工具
市面上有很多端口扫描工具,下面我将推荐两款适合个人使用的工具:
1. Nmap(Network Mapper)
Nmap 是一款功能强大的开源网络扫描工具,它可以帮助你发现网络上的设备、开放端口和运行的服务。Nmap 的使用界面简洁,功能丰富,非常适合初学者。
2. Masscan
Masscan 是一款快速、高效的端口扫描工具,它可以同时对目标主机的所有端口进行扫描。相较于 Nmap,Masscan 在扫描速度上具有明显优势。
三、下载与安装
以下是两款工具的下载与安装步骤:
1. Nmap
- 访问 Nmap 的官方网站:https://nmap.org/
- 在官网上下载适用于你操作系统的版本。
- 解压下载的文件,运行安装脚本。
2. Masscan
- 访问 Masscan 的官方网站:https://masscan.org/
- 在官网上下载适用于你操作系统的版本。
- 解压下载的文件,运行安装脚本。
四、使用端口扫描工具
以下是使用 Nmap 进行端口扫描的示例:
# 查看帮助信息
nmap --help
# 扫描目标主机的所有端口
nmap 192.168.1.1
# 扫描目标主机的特定端口
nmap -p 80,443 192.168.1.1
# 扫描目标主机的指定范围端口
nmap -p 1-1000 192.168.1.1
对于 Masscan,你可以使用以下命令进行扫描:
# 扫描目标主机的所有端口
masscan 192.168.1.1
# 扫描目标主机的特定端口
masscan -p 80,443 192.168.1.1
# 扫描目标主机的指定范围端口
masscan -p 1-1000 192.168.1.1
五、分析扫描结果
扫描完成后,Nmap 和 Masscan 都会生成一个 HTML 格式的报告,你可以通过浏览器打开这个报告来查看扫描结果。报告中会列出目标主机上的开放端口、运行的服务以及相关的安全风险。
六、总结
通过以上步骤,你已经学会了如何下载并使用端口扫描工具来检测网络安全隐患。记住,端口扫描只是网络安全检测的一部分,为了确保网络安全,你还需要采取其他安全措施,如更新系统补丁、使用防火墙等。
